Fiji’s Taniela Rainibogi is going to wear gold: he backs up his dominant display in the snatch with a clean-and-jerk lift of 208kg. That brings him to a total of 378kg, and he finishes four kilos ahead of England’s Cyrille Tchatchet II. Samoa’s Jack Opeloge, making a dash for bronze by trying to lift a monstrous 210kg, has a nasty fall with his second attempt – and doesn’t fare much better with his third. Canada’s Xavier Lusignan takes third.
